Overview
The GE DS200DDTBG2A is a high-speed auxiliary I/O terminal board for LS2100 and Mark V LM systems. It manages digital inputs, analog outputs, and relay signals for turbine and industrial drive applications. The board interfaces with the DS200ADMA analog-to-digital module via a 50-pin ribbon cable. It supports solenoids, contactors, and high-speed field devices, ensuring reliable signal processing in harsh industrial environments. The DS200DDTBG2A improves system response time and enables accurate monitoring for Load Commutated Inverter (LCI) applications.
Technical Specifications
Electrical Characteristics
- Power Supply: 24 VDC (18–32 V range) via backplane
- Power Consumption: < 8 W
- Analog Outputs: 4 channels, 0–10 VDC, 12-bit resolution (TP14–TP17)
- Digital Inputs: 8 channels, optically isolated, 24 VDC, ≤2 ms filtering (TP17–TP25)
- Relay Outputs: 16 Form-C relays, rated 2 A @ 240 VAC or 10 A @ 30 VDC
- Isolated Status Outputs: 4 channels, 48 VDC / 10 mA
- LED Indicators: Real-time channel and relay status
Physical & Diagnostic Features
- Test Points: 33 TP locations for voltage and continuity checks
- Jumpers: 12 sets for signal type, filter time, and address selection
- Surge Protection: 8 MOVs up to 8 kV
- Isolation: 2 miniature transformers for auxiliary power
- Signal Conditioning: 14 high-speed transistors and 15 resistor networks
Environmental Ratings
- Operating Temperature: –40°C to +85°C
- Humidity: Industrial-grade conformal coating, passed 1000-hour salt spray
- MTBF: > 250,000 hours
Dimensions & Mounting
- Size: 159 mm × 127 mm × 25 mm
- Form Factor: 6U single-slot board
- Weight: 0.6 kg
- Mounting: Panel or rack-mounted
